From Theory to Practice: The Sherman Method

Their contributions stem from a deliberate methodological framework—the Sherman Method—that has become a benchmark in enterprise transformation. This system compresses years of R&D into actionable playbooks, enabling organizations to scale innovation without sacrificing stability.

The Sherman Method rests on four pillars:

  1. Virtual Prototyping: Companies simulate AI-driven processes in controlled digital environments before real-world deployment, reducing risk and accelerating validation.

  2. Ethical Data Stewardship: They advocate for transparent data practices, embedding privacy by design into every stage of development.
  3. Cross-Functional Integration: Breaking down silos, Christopher and Tyler foster collaboration between engineers, business strategists, and end users.
  4. Continuous Learning Loops: Real-time feedback mechanisms ensure systems adapt dynamically to evolving needs.

Data as a Strategic Asset, Not a Cost

In an era saturated with data, Christopher and Tyler reframe analytics from expense to strategic advantage.

They advocate for data literacy across all organizational levels, turning raw information into actionable intelligence. Their consulting playbook emphasizes three key steps:

  • Audit data quality and governance frameworks to ensure reliability.
  • Deploy modular analytics platforms that evolve with business needs.

  • Foster cross-departmental data collaboration through structured training and shared KPIs.
At a major healthcare provider, their intervention unlocked hidden insights from patient data—improving diagnostic accuracy by 22% and reducing administrative overhead. “Data isn’t just information,” Christopher states. “It’s a silent partner in better decisions—if leveraged with purpose.”
